Children's comics and magazines are doing fine and dandy
Many of us will remember comic book heroes Dennis the Menace, Minnie the Minx and Desperate Dan. And while you might think that when faced with competition from modern technology, comic books would have been left behind, latest research from Mintel shows that this childhood classic is still going strong today- albeit with a modern twist.Indeed, things are looking good in the world of comics and children’s magazines. Valued at £136 million this year, sales have seen a massive 72% growth since 2003. Meanwhile, sales of women’s magazines increased by just 15% over the same period and teenage magazines declined by 61%.
